War in South Ossetia

PanARMENIAN.Net - Georgian military occupied several districts in Tskhinvali and 11 villages. Some 600 Georgian soldiers are in the capital of the South Ossetia at present, Rustavi-2 TV channel reports.



Georgian forces are shelling camps of Russian peacekeepers. There are wounded and killed.



The news about attack on Tskhinvali came in the night, following reports from South Ossetian state committee on information and press that Georgia is planning a large-scale operation against the breakaway republic, Regions.ru reports.
